Seen a two inch drop on a Lightning last night at a show in Tampa. Used a hanger kit instead of a shakle kit. He said it was very hard to get the rivets out but he likes the looks of the hanger drop over the shakle drop because it gives a better rake to the vehicle. The truck looked good.
